2005 Audi A4 vs. 2003 Jaguar X-Type
To start off, 2005 Audi A4 is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2003 Jaguar X-Type.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2003 Jaguar X-Type would be higher. At 2,983 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Audi A4 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Audi A4 (220 HP @ 6500 RPM) has 63 more horse power than 2003 Jaguar X-Type. (157 HP @ 6800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Audi A4 should accelerate faster than 2003 Jaguar X-Type.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Audi A4 weights approximately 310 kg more than 2003 Jaguar X-Type.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2005 Audi A4 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2003 Jaguar X-Type.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Audi A4 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Audi A4 (300 Nm) has 104 more torque (in Nm) than 2003 Jaguar X-Type. (196 Nm). This means 2005 Audi A4 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2003 Jaguar X-Type.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Audi A4 | 2003 Jaguar X-Type | |
Make | Audi | Jaguar |
Model | A4 | X-Type |
Year Released | 2005 | 2003 |
Body Type | Convertible |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2983 cc | 2099 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 220 HP | 157 HP |
Engine RPM | 6500 RPM | 6800 RPM |
Torque | 300 Nm | 196 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 83 mm | 81.6 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 93 mm | 66.8 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.1:1 | 10.8:1 |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1820 kg | 1510 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4580 mm | 4720 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1800 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1490 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2580 mm | 2600 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 9.4 L/100km | 7.2 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 13.1 L/100km | 12.9 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.2 L/100km | 9.3 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 66 L | 61 L |
